Reggae music, with its infectious rhythms and powerful messages, has captivated audiences around the world for decades· Originating in Jamaica in the late 1960s, reggae quickly gained popularity and became a symbol of resistance, unity, and love· Its unique blend of African, Caribbean, and American musical influences, coupled with its socially conscious lyrics, has made reggae a genre that transcends time and continues to resonate with people of all backgrounds· In this article, we will explore the top five reggae songs of all time, each representing a different aspect of the genre’s enduring appeal·
Bob Marley’s One Love – A Universal Anthem of Unity and Love
No discussion of reggae music would be complete without mentioning the legendary Bob Marley· His song “One Love” is not only one of his most iconic tracks but also a universal anthem of unity and love· Released in 1977, the song’s message of coming together as one human family resonates as strongly today as it did over four decades ago· With lyrics like “One love, one heart, let’s get together and feel alright,” Marley’s call for unity transcends borders, cultures, and generations· “One Love” has become a symbol of hope and a reminder that love can conquer all·
Peter Tosh’s Legalize It – A Powerful Call for Marijuana Legalization
Reggae music has long been associated with the Rastafari movement, which holds marijuana as a sacrament· Peter Tosh, a founding member of The Wailers alongside Bob Marley, used his music as a platform to advocate for the legalization of marijuana· His song “Legalize It,” released in 1976, is a powerful call to end the prohibition of cannabis· Tosh’s lyrics highlight the medicinal and spiritual benefits of the plant, challenging the societal stigma surrounding it· With lines like “Doctors smoke it, nurses smoke it, judges smoke it, even the lawyer too,” Tosh emphasizes the widespread use of marijuana and questions its criminalization· “Legalize It” remains a rallying cry for marijuana activists worldwide·
Jimmy Cliff’s Many Rivers to Cross – A Soul-Stirring Journey of Resilience
Jimmy Cliff’s “Many Rivers to Cross” is a soul-stirring reggae ballad that explores the theme of resilience in the face of adversity· Released in 1969, the song’s introspective lyrics and Cliff’s emotive vocals create a powerful narrative of struggle and hope· The metaphor of crossing rivers symbolizes the challenges and obstacles we encounter in life, and Cliff’s impassioned delivery resonates with listeners on a deep emotional level· “Many Rivers to Cross” has been covered by numerous artists and featured in films, solidifying its status as a timeless reggae classic·
Burning Spear’s Marcus Garvey – A Tribute to the Pan-African Leader
Burning Spear’s “Marcus Garvey” pays homage to the influential Pan-African leader and Jamaican national hero· Released in 1975, the song is a powerful tribute to Marcus Garvey’s teachings and philosophy of black pride and empowerment· Burning Spear’s lyrics, delivered with conviction and passion, celebrate Garvey’s legacy and call for unity among people of African descent· With lines like “Marcus Garvey words come to pass, Marcus Garvey words come to pass,” the song serves as a reminder of the enduring impact of Garvey’s teachings and the ongoing struggle for racial equality·
Toots and the Maytals’ Pressure Drop – A Classic Reggae Groove with a Message
Toots and the Maytals’ “Pressure Drop” is a classic reggae groove that combines infectious rhythms with a powerful message· Released in 1969, the song’s catchy melody and Toots Hibbert’s soulful vocals make it an instant crowd-pleaser· However, beneath the surface lies a deeper meaning· “Pressure Drop” refers to the stress and hardships of everyday life, and Toots’ lyrics convey a sense of resilience and determination in the face of adversity· The song’s popularity and influence have been recognized through its inclusion in various films and its impact on the development of reggae music·

🌿 What Is the Spirit of Gluttony?
Gluttony is more than simply eating too much. It’s an excessive desire to consume, often driven by emotional, psychological, or spiritual emptiness. When food becomes a way to fill a void, escape discomfort, or cope with stress, gluttony takes hold.
In spiritual terms, gluttony reflects a disconnection from balance, purpose, and gratitude. Over time, it can dull intuition, drain energy, and block deeper connections to your higher self and the divine.
🔍 Signs of Gluttony: How to Recognize It
Recognizing gluttony’s presence is the first step toward change. Here are common signs to watch for:
✅ Mindless Eating – Consuming food without paying attention to taste, hunger, or fullness. ✅ Eating Beyond Satiety – Feeling uncomfortably full but continuing to eat. ✅ Using Food to Cope – Turning to food when stressed, sad, or bored. ✅ Guilt or Shame After Eating – Feeling regret or self-loathing after overindulgence. ✅ Cravings for Rich or Sugary Foods – Seeking comfort through hyper-palatable foods. ✅ Loss of Connection with True Hunger – Eating out of habit, routine, or emotional triggers rather than physical need. ✅ Non-Food Gluttony – Overindulging in shopping, media consumption, or other habits that numb feelings or create temporary pleasure.
These signs are invitations for reflection, not reasons for judgment.
